We also corrected a double-counting bug in the per-pod label merge: counters with identical names but differing unit tags are now rejected at ingest with a structured warning. Memory ceiling is unchanged at 128 MiB. Reviewers should focus on the merge-path refactor in aggregator/merge.go. Direct any questions about these changes to the maintainer named below.

account owner for fajep-yagef: Kasix Eliiel

## Limits and quotas: Cartovane tile cache

The cache layer sits between the renderer and edge nodes. Eviction is
strictly LRU per zoom band, and the quotas below were chosen to keep
warm-set hit rates above 92% under the Ostermead traffic profile.
Please treat them as a matched set; changing one in isolation has
historically caused thrash. They are:

tuning table, yajog-yahof:
BUDGETS = {
    "lamvan": 303,
    "wenox": 460,
    "fenvan": 525,
}

Subject: Mail Room Relocation

Hi Facilities,

As of Monday, the mail room moves from Level 1 to the annex behind the Kestrel Wing loading bay. Courier deliveries should be redirected there, and the old room will be locked for refurbishment. Sorting shelves and the franking machine go over Friday evening. The new door requires the code below.

— Front Desk, Harrowfield House

staff pass of kawip-hawef = bdg-QLP-2

Welcome to on-call for the Glimmerpane design system! Our snapshot tests live in the `snapcheck` suite and run on every merge to main. If a UI component changes visually, the diff bot flags it — usually it's an intentional tweak, so just approve the new baseline. If it's 2am and snapshots are failing across the board, it's almost always a font-loading race, not your problem. To unlock the baseline store and re-approve snapshots in bulk, use the recovery passphrase below.

recovery phrase for tahag-taguf: wenix-caswyn